Understanding Root Canal Therapy
A root canal treatment, technically known as endodontic therapy, is a dental procedure aimed at treating infection or inflammation within the tooth’s pulp. This intricate procedure involves removing the diseased pulp, carefully cleaning and disinfecting the inside of the tooth, and then filling and sealing the space. The goal is to eliminate pain and prevent future infection, ultimately saving the tooth from extraction. The Root Canal Procedure Explained
The process of a root canal generally follows a series of well-defined steps, often completed by skilled endodontists or general dentists with advanced training. Understanding these steps can help alleviate any apprehension you might feel about the procedure.
The typical stages of a root canal treatment include:
- Diagnosis and Examination: This initial step involves a thorough examination, often including X-rays, to assess the extent of the pulp damage or infection. Your dentist will discuss the findings and recommend the best course of action.
- Anesthesia: Local anesthetic is administered to numb the area, ensuring the procedure is as comfortable as possible. Many patients are surprised by how pain-free the process is once anesthesia takes effect.
- Accessing the Pulp: A small opening is made in the crown of the tooth to allow access to the pulp chamber and root canals.
- Cleaning and Disinfection: The infected or inflamed pulp tissue is carefully removed from the pulp chamber and root canals. The canals are then thoroughly cleaned, disinfected, and shaped. Specialized instruments and irrigating solutions are used to ensure all debris and bacteria are eliminated.
- Filling the Canals: Once cleaned, the root canals are filled with a biocompatible material, typically gutta-percha, to seal them completely. This prevents bacteria from re-entering the tooth.
- Sealing the Opening: The small opening made in the crown of the tooth is then sealed with a temporary or permanent filling.
- Restoration: In most cases, a permanent restoration, such as a dental crown, is placed over the treated tooth. This protects the tooth from further damage and restores its full function and appearance. Materials and Methods Commonly Used
Modern endodontic practices in areas like Evans, Georgia, emphasize precision and patient comfort. Dentists often employ advanced technologies and high-quality materials to achieve optimal results. This can include rotary instruments for efficient shaping of the root canals, microscope-assisted procedures for enhanced visualization, and bioceramic sealers for improved sealing properties. The selection of materials is crucial for the longevity and success of the root canal treatment, ensuring the tooth remains healthy for years to come.

Preserving Your Natural Tooth
The primary benefit of a root canal is the preservation of your natural tooth. Extracting a tooth can lead to a cascade of other dental issues, including shifting of adjacent teeth, difficulty chewing, and potential bone loss in the jaw. By opting for endodontic treatment, you maintain the integrity of your bite and the natural appearance of your smile, avoiding the need for more complex and costly tooth replacement options.
Alleviating Pain and Discomfort
One of the most immediate benefits of a successful root canal is the significant reduction, and often complete elimination, of tooth pain. Infections within the pulp can cause severe throbbing pain, sensitivity to hot and cold, and discomfort when biting. Root canal therapy addresses the source of this pain, restoring comfort and allowing you to enjoy your favorite foods and activities without interruption.

Preventing Future Infections
By thoroughly cleaning and sealing the tooth’s internal structure, root canal therapy effectively prevents the spread of infection to other parts of the mouth or body. This proactive measure is vital for maintaining overall health and avoiding more serious complications.

Is a root canal considered a painful procedure?
Modern root canal procedures are typically not more painful than having a tooth filled. With advancements in anesthetics and techniques, the discomfort experienced during and after a root canal is usually minimal. Most patients report feeling relief from tooth pain almost immediately after the procedure. Your dentist in Evans will ensure you are comfortable throughout the treatment.
What kind of post-treatment care is needed after a root canal?
After a root canal, your dentist will provide specific post-treatment care instructions. Generally, you should maintain good oral hygiene, brushing and flossing regularly. It’s important to attend your follow-up appointments to ensure the tooth is healing properly and to receive a permanent restoration, such as a crown, if it hasn’t been placed already. Avoiding chewing on the treated tooth until the permanent restoration is in place is also recommended to prevent damage.
